Duoball

Alternatively or in addition to the classic Blackroll, there is now the so-called Duoball. Two polystyrene balls attached to each other with their recess in the middle offer an optimal self-massage product for back and neck. The spine is thus located in the recess and soft tissue structures are reached more comfortably. Blackroll offers the Duoball roll in two different sizes (8 and 12cm diameter). The large roll is more suitable for the back and the small one for the neck, but can also be used on other parts of the body.

Fascial Training

In order to keep the fasciae in the body supple, there is not only the fascia roller but also a special fascia training. The exercises are holistic, large movements, many repetitions, stressing whole muscle chains instead of just individual muscles. Fascial training includes stretching exercises, exercises for the promotion of elasticity, tissue relaxation, fine tuning, strengthening of the chains, … An optimal whole body training for everyone. Fascial training is increasingly offered for groups, individual exercises are used in therapies or added to the training of sports groups.

Exercises for neck

To treat the neck with the Blackroll, the small Duoball is particularly suitable – however, the exercises can be performed on both rolls. 1.) In supine position, the legs are upright, the roll lies under the neck.

Now roll up and down in small slow movements. By shifting the body weight the pressure intensity can be dosed by yourself. Alternatively, the exercise can be performed while standing on a wall.

2.) For another exercise, also in supine position, the roll is placed in the upper neck at the end of the skull bone. The head lies relaxed and is first turned slowly to the right and left, then tilted up and down like a nodding movement. After a few repetitions, the roll is moved a little further down and the same movements are performed again. The practical and handy size of the small roll makes it easy to take it with you to the office or to your workplace and use it as compensation during short breaks.
